Origin of creativity and community connection

Founded on September 9, 2013, the Communication Club of the VNU University of Law (CCFD) has established itself as one of the most dynamic and professional clubs at the university. Guided by its three core values: Connection – Responsibility – Passion, CCFD is not only a gathering place for young media enthusiasts but also a bridge linking generations of students, helping members learn, develop skills, and build personal resilience. Moreover, CCFD actively supports the activities of the Youth Union, Student Association, and major events at the school. It is a space where creative ideas come to life, dreams take flight, and efforts dedicated to the community are recognized and celebrated.

Outstanding and creative in each activity

The CCFD Communication Club has solidified its position through creative and meaningful activities that bring practical value to students. Its annual information segments, such as CCNEWS, CCinema, CCLAW, CChannel, and CCFM, not only provide timely updates but also create a space for creative entertainment, connecting students both within and beyond the university.

In recent times, CCFD has organized and participated in several significant events. Highlights include the slogan contest “Your Slogan – Your Action” to celebrate the 92nd anniversary of the Ho Chi Minh Communist Youth Union, the program “Trip to Law Law Land” to help K68 freshmen integrate into their academic environment, and participation in the Media Department of the VNU Student Union Congress for the 2023–2024 term. The club also left a mark with the film project “Wheel of Fortune,” delivering profound humanitarian messages, as well as competitions promoting legal awareness about gender equality and environmental protection.

Additionally, CCFD actively supports media and image promotion for the career fair “Future Fest 2024 – The Law Express,” offering numerous job opportunities for students. Internally, the club fosters engagement through activities like a prom night honoring alumni from K64 and K65 and a series of media campaigns supporting K66 and K67 during their military training period.

The CCFD Communication Club comprises a dynamic team of nearly 100 members, actively and effectively operating across four specialized departments: Media, Technical, Content, and External Relations – Logistics. This structure ensures the club’s professional and versatile performance in all areas. With relentless creativity, the dedication of each member, and seamless collaboration between subcommittees, CCFD not only meets the communication needs within the university but is also expanding its influence beyond the student community.
